Dapone and atovaquone are therapeutic options for PJP prophylaxis in renal transplant recipients. The objective of this study was to evaluate the incidence of anemia in renal transplant recipients receiving these agents.

This is an IRB-approved, retrospective analysis of adult renal transplant recipients who received either dapsone or atovaquone. The primary endpoint was the change in hemoglobin within 90days of drug initiation. Other endpoints of interest included incidence and management of anemia at multiple time points post-transplant. Categorical variables were compared with Pearson's chi-squared or Fischer's exact test and continuous data were compared utilizing Wilcoxon rank-sum test. Statistical analyses were performed using Stata 14.2.

A total of 478 patients were screened for inclusion; 50 patients were evaluated in both the dapsone and atovaquone groups. In the dapsone and atovaquone groups, the median age was 52 and 50.5years, 44% and 42% were Caucasian, and median time to treatment initiation was 27 and 39days post-transplant, respectively. All patients receiving dapsone had normal G6PD function. There was no difference in baseline hemoglobin between groups (9.7g/dL vs 9.8g/dL, P=.83). The median nadir hemoglobin values were 8.6g/dL and 9.6g/dL in the dapsone and atovaquone groups, respectively (P=.047). The median decrease in hemoglobin from baseline to nadir was 1.3g/dL in dapsone patients and 0.2g/dL in atovaquone patients (P=.001). Dapsone was discontinued in 46% of patients, whereas atovaquone was discontinued in 18% (P=.001).

Among renal transplant recipients with normal G6PD activity, dapsone is associated with greater hemoglobin reductions and rates of drug discontinuation as compared to atovaquone.

This study aims to explore the prevalence rates of stigma and fear among people in Jordan during COVID-19 pandemic and to assess socio-demographic and personal factors contributing to the prevalence rates of fear and stigma among people in Jordan during COVID-19 pandemic.

Cross-sectional descriptive design was utilized to attain the study aim. An anonymous online survey targeting people of Jordan was used and distributed to adults in Arabic language. The survey included a previously validated fear scale. Stigma was measured using developed instrument by authors.

The prevalence of fear among study participants was 52%. In addition, the prevalence of stigma towards infected people and their contact was 64%. The predictors of stigma towards infected people with COVID-19 and their contact were income, living area and downloaded application to trace COVID-19 cases. Moreover the predictors of fear were income living area and downloaded application to trace COVID-19 cases (P≤ .001).

More than 50% of the respondents were afraid from COVID-19 and 64% had stigma towards infected people and their contact during the COVID-19 pandemic. The present study highlights the need for an intervention that provides psychological support to citizens during the pandemic.

In this study, we aimed to investigate the clinical and demographic characteristics of asymptomatic COVID-19 cases incidentally diagnosed at the emergency department.

This study retrospectively analysed the medical data of patients who presented to the emergency department, between March 1 and May 1, 2020, without COVID-19 symptoms such as fever, cough, myalgia on admission but were incidentally detected to have thoracic computerised tomography (CT) findings suggestive of COVID-19. GSK1210151A inhibitor The patients' sociodemographic and epidemiological characteristics, laboratory test results, clinical and radiological findings, treatment protocols and prognoses were recorded.

We incidentally diagnosed COVID-19 pneumonia in 81 asymptomatic patients. All patients presented to the emergency department with traumatic injuries. Of these, 38 (46%) were injured in in-vehicle traffic accidents; 27 (34%) out-of-vehicle traffic accidents; 14 (18%) simple falls; and 2 (2%) falls from a height. Only 42 (48%) patients had a history of any patient without wearing PPE.

Early identification and isolation of asymptomatic patients are of great importance for reducing the speed of propagation of the COVID-19 pandemic. Incidentally diagnosed cases have made us consider that there is a need to increase the number of screening tests. Arabidopsis CK1 family member MUT9-LIKE KINASEs, such as MLK1 and MLK3, have been shown to phosphorylate histone H3 at threonine 3 (H3T3), an evolutionarily conserved residue, and the modification is associated with the transcriptional repression of euchromatic and heterochromatic loci. This study demonstrates that mlk4-3, a T-DNA insertion mutant of MLK4, flowered late, and that overexpression of MLK4 caused early flowering. The nuclear protein MLK4 phosphorylated histone H3T3 both in vitro and in vivo, and this catalytic activity required the conserved lysine residue K175. mutation of MLK4 at K175 failed to restore the level of phosphorylated H3T3 (H3T3ph) or to complement the phenotypic defects of mlk4-3. The FLC/MAF-clade genes, including FLC, MAF4 and MAF5, were significantly upregulated in mlk4-3. The double mutant mlk4-3 flc-3 flowered earlier than mlk4-3, suggesting that functional FLC is crucial for flowering repression in mlk4-3. Chromatin immunoprecipitation assays showed that MLK4 bound to FLC/MAF chromatin and that H3T3ph occupancy at the promoter of FLC/MAF was negatively associated with its transcriptional level. In accordance, H3T3ph accumulated at FLC/MAF in 35SMLK4/mlk4-3 but diminished in 35SMLK4(K175R)/mlk4-3 plants. Moreover, the amount of RNA Pol II deposited at FLC/MAF was clearly enriched in mlk4-3 relative to the wild type. Therefore, MLK4-dependent phosphorylation of H3T3 contributes to accelerating flowering by repressing the transcription of negative flowering regulator FLC/MAF. This study sheds light on the delicate control of flowering by the plant-specific CK1, MLK4, via post-translational modification of histone H3.
